Specifications 
Lufenuron 98%TC, 10%SC, 5%EC 
Common name: Lurfenuron 
Chemical name (IUPAC): 
(RS)-1-[2, 5-dichloro-4-(1, 1, 2, 3, 3, 3-hexafluoropropoxy) phenyl]-3-(2, 6-difluoro = benzoyl) urea 
CAS No.: 103055-07-8 
Empirical formula: C17H8Cl2F8N2O3 
Physical & Chemical Properties 
Form: Colourless crystals. 
M. P. 168.7-169.4 ° C (OECD 102) 
V. P. <4 ´ 10-3 MPa (25 º C) (OECD 104) 
KOW logP = 5.12 (25 º C) (OECD 117) 
S. G. /density 1.66 at 20 º C (OECD 109) 
Solubility In water: <0.06 mg/l (25 º C). 
In ethanol 41, acetone 460, toluene 72, n-hexane 0.13, n-octanol 8.9 (all in g/l, 25 º C). 
Stability Stable in air and light. 
Toxicity 
Oral Acute oral LD50 for rats: >2000 mg/kg. 
Skin and eye Acute percutaneous LD50 for rats: >2000 mg/kg. 
Non-irritating to eyes and skin (rabbits) 
Non-sensitising to skin (Guinea pigs) 
Inhalation LC50 (4 h, 20 º C) for rats: >2.35 mg/l air. 
NOEL (2 y) for rats: 2.0 mg/kg b. W. Daily. 
ADI: 0.01 mg/kg. Toxicity class WHO (a. I. ): III 
EC hazard (R43) 
Birds Acute oral LD50 for bobwhite quail and mallard ducks: >2000 mg/kg. 
Dietary LC50 (8 d) for bobwhite quail and mallard ducks: >5200 mg/kg. 
Fish LC50 (96 h) for rainbow trout >73, carp >63, bluegill sunfish >29, catfish >45 mg/l. 
Daphnia: Toxic to Daphnia. 
Algae: Slightly toxic to algae. 
Bees LC50 (oral): >197 mg/bee 
LD50 (topical): >200 mg/bee. 
Worms: No adverse effects on earthworms. 

Application 
Biochemistry inhibits chitin synthesis. Mode of action Acts mostly by ingestion; Larvae are unable to moult, and also cease feeding. Uses insect growth regulator for control of iepidoptera and ioleoptera larvae on cotton, maize and vegetables and citrus whitefly and rust mites on citrus fruit, at 10-50 g/ha. Also use for the prevention and control of flea infestations on pets. Formulation types EC. 
Compatibility: Not compatible with pesticides with alkaline reaction (lime sulfur, copper).
